Навіщо імпортувати дані
Кожна інформаційна система створює власні дані. Система керування взаємодією з клієнтами (CRM) може містити дані про рейтинг лояльності клієнтів, їх загальну цінність, улюблені товари тощо. Видавці вебсайтів можуть зберігати в системі керування контентом такі параметри, як ім’я автора або категорія статті. Якщо ви займаєтесь електронною комерцією, то зберігаєте такі атрибути товарів, як ціна, стиль і розмір.
Ви також можете аналізувати трафік і ефективність вебсайтів і додатків за допомогою Analytics.
Зазвичай ці дані зберігаються ізольовано й не пов’язуються з іншою інформацією. Імпортування даних дає змогу об’єднати всю цю інформацію в Analytics у певному розкладі, щоб уніфікувати її, отримувати нову статистику, а також легко переглядати й аналізувати доступні відомості.
Як працює функція імпортування даних
Завантаження даних
У ресурс Analytics завантажуються файли CSV, що містять зовнішні дані. Ви можете експортувати ці файли CSV з автономного інструмента, наприклад системи керування контентом або взаємодією з клієнтами. А для менших обсягів даних файли можна створити вручну за допомогою текстового редактора чи електронної таблиці.
Функція імпортування даних об’єднує офлайн-дані, які ви завантажили, з даними про події, котрі збирає Analytics. Імпортовані дані доповнюють ваші звіти, порівняння й аудиторії, завдяки чому ви отримуєте краще уявлення про дії онлайн і офлайн.
Об’єднання даних
Залежно від типу імпортованих даних вони можуть об’єднуватися двома різними способами.
- За часом збору чи обробки. Імпортовані дані об’єднуються з тими, які збирає Analytics, і обробляються як отримані з події. Об’єднані дані вносяться у зведені таблиці Analytics. Імпортовані дані не об’єднуються з історичними даними Analytics, які вже оброблено. Якщо видалити імпортований файл, дані більше не об’єднуватимуться, однак уже об’єднані дані залишаться.
Дані користувача і офлайн-події об’єднуються під час їх збору й обробки.
- За часом запиту чи створення звіту. Імпортовані дані об’єднуються з тими, які збирає Analytics, коли ви відкриваєте звіт і Analytics надсилає запит на дані для нього. Таке об’єднання тимчасове. Якщо видалити імпортований файл, дані більше не об’єднуватимуться, а вже об’єднані дані більше не будуть доступні в Analytics.
Дані про витрати, товари й спеціальні події об’єднуються під час створення звіту або виконання запиту.
Дані про час створення звітів і запитів недоступні, коли ви створюєте аудиторії в Analytics або сегменти в Дослідженнях.
Під час імпортування даних раніше передана інформація зберігається, доки не буде додано нові відомості. Зверніть увагу: якщо ці нові дані міститимуть той самий набір ключів, що й попередні, раніше передану інформацію буде перезаписано.
Типи метаданих, які можна імпортувати
Метадані
Імпортовані метадані додаються до вже зібраних і оброблених ресурсом. Зазвичай метадані зберігаються в спеціальному параметрі чи показнику, хоча іноді за допомогою них можна перезаписати вже зібрані дані за умовчанням (наприклад, імпортувати каталог продукції з оновленими категоріями).
Можна імпортувати наведені нижче типи даних.
- Дані про витрати: дані сторонніх рекламних мереж (не Google) про кліки, вартість і покази
- Дані про товар: метадані про товар, як-от розмір, колір, стиль і інші пов’язані з ним параметри
- Дані користувача: метадані про користувача, як-от коефіцієнт лояльності або показник цінності клієнта за весь період, на основі яких можна створювати сегменти й списки ремаркетингу
- Офлайн-події: офлайн-події з джерел, які не мають інтернет-з’єднання або з інших причин не підтримують збирання даних у реальному часі
- Дані про спеціальні події: метадані про події, які імпортуються за допомогою стандартних полів і/або спеціальних параметрів
Обмеження
Розмір джерела даних | 1 ГБ |
Щоденні завантаження |
120 завантажень на день для ресурсу |
Тип даних імпорту | Обмеження джерела даних на ресурс | Ліміт пам’яті для кожного типу даних |
---|---|---|
Дані про витрати | До 5 | 1 ГБ на всі джерела імпорту |
Дані про товар | До 5 | 1 ГБ на всі джерела імпорту |
Дані користувача | До 10 | Не застосовується |
Офлайн-події | До 10 | Не застосовується |
Дані про спеціальні події | До 5 | 1 ГБ на всі джерела імпорту |
Щоб дізнатись, яку частину квоти використано в продукті, натисніть кнопку "Інформація про квоту".
Як імпортувати дані
Під час імпортування даних ви створюєте їх джерело. Джерело даних – це комбінація файлу CSV, який потрібно завантажити, і зіставлення наявних полів Analytics із полями файлу CSV (див. приклад нижче).
Не завантажуйте файл, який містить копії ключів (наприклад, 2 поля з назвою user_id).
Вимоги для завантаження даних через протокол SFTP
Якщо ви збираєтеся використовувати протокол SFTP в кроці 5, переконайтеся, що сервер SFTP підтримує алгоритми ключа хоста ssh-rsa
і ssh-dss
. Дізнайтеся більше про те, як перевірити, які алгоритми ключа хоста ви використовуєте, і як відформатувати URL-адресу сервера SFTP.
Як почати імпортування
- На сторінці адміністратора у розділі Збирання й змінення даних натисніть Імпортування даних.
За попереднім посиланням відкриється останній ресурс Analytics, у який ви входили. Щоб змінити ресурс, скористайтеся засобом вибору ресурсу. Ви повинні мати принаймні права редактора на рівні ресурсу, щоб почати імпортування.
- Виберіть джерело даних або створіть нове (вказівки наведено в розділах нижче).
Як створити джерело даних
- Натисніть Створити джерело даних.
- Введіть назву джерела даних.
- Виберіть тип даних:
- дані про витрати (імпортування лише під час запиту);
- дані про товар (імпортування під час запиту чи створення звіту);
- дані користувача за ідентифікатором користувача (імпортування під час збору чи обробки даних);
- дані користувача за ідентифікатором клієнта (імпортування під час збору чи обробки даних);
- дані офлайн-події (імпортування під час збору чи обробки даних);
- дані про спеціальні події (імпортування під час запиту чи створення звіту).
- Натисніть Переглянути умови, якщо з’явиться така підказка. Вона відображається, якщо ви імпортуєте дані користувача або пристрою.
- Виконайте одну з наведених нижче дій.
- Натисніть Завантаження файлів CSV вручну, виберіть відповідний файл на комп’ютері й натисніть Відкрити.
- Виберіть SFTP.
- Ім’я користувача на сервері SFTP: укажіть своє ім’я для такого сервера.
- URL-адреса сервера SFTP: укажіть URL-адресу для такого сервера.
- Частота: виберіть, як часто потрібно завантажувати дані (щодня, щотижня чи щомісяця).
- Час початку: укажіть бажаний час початку завантаження даних.
- Після створення джерела даних відкритий ключ для сервера SFTP з’явиться в інтерфейсі, у якому ви створюєте джерело даних, і стане доступним у відомостях про джерело даних (див. нижче).
- Натисніть Далі, щоб перейти до зіставлення.
- Виберіть поля Analytics і імпортовані поля, які потрібно зіставити. За потреби змініть назви полів.
- Натисніть Імпортувати.
Як завантажити дані в джерело даних
- У рядку джерела даних натисніть Імпортувати.
- Якщо джерело даних налаштовано для імпортування файлу CSV, виберіть відповідний файл і натисніть Відкрити.
Файл CSV має містити той самий набір полів, повністю або частково, що й початкове джерело даних. Якщо ви хочете імпортувати різні поля для того самого типу даних, потрібно видалити наявне джерело й створити нове.
Дані, імпортовані в первинний ресурс, буде автоматично експортовано у зведені й підпорядковані ресурси.
Перевірка алгоритмів ключа хоста SFTP; форматування URL-адреси сервера SFTP
Як перевірити алгоритми
Є різні способи перевірити, який алгоритм ключа хоста (ssh-rsa чи ssh-dss) використовує ваш сервер SFTP. Наприклад, використовуючи клієнт віддаленого входу OpenSSH, можна перевіряти журнали сервера за допомогою такої команди:
ssh -vv <your sftp server name>
Якщо ваш сервер підтримує один із цих алгоритмів, у журналі сервера має відображатися такий рядок:
debug2: host key algorithms: rsa-sha2-512, rsa-sha2-256, ssh-rsa
Як відформатувати URL-адресу сервера SFTP
Якщо URL-адреса сервера SFTP має неправильний формат, налаштувати імпортування не вдасться, і з’явиться повідомлення про внутрішню помилку.
URL-адреса сервера SFTP складається з 3 частин, які потрібно врахувати під час завантаження файлів (див. приклад нижче).
URL-адреса sftp://example.com//home/jon/upload.csv
містить наведені нижче частини.
- Домен:
example.com
- Головний каталог:
//home/jon
- Шлях до файлу:
/upload.csv
У прикладі вище файл для завантаження розміщується в головному каталозі.
Доменну частину URL-адреси можна вказати в різних форматах: як доменне ім’я чи як IP-адресу сервера за протоколом IPv4 або IPv6 (з номером порту чи без нього). Нижче наведено приклади.
- Доменне ім’я:
sftp://example.com
- Адреса IPv4 (з номером порту):
sftp://142.250.189.4:1234
- Адреса IPv4 (без номера порту):
sftp://142.250.189.4
- Адреса IPv6 (з номером порту):
sftp://[2607:f8b0:4007:817::2004]:1234
- Адреса IPv6 (без номера порту):
sftp://[2607:f8b0:4007:817::2004]
Якщо не вказати номер порту, за умовчанням буде вибрано порт 22.
Щоб включити або виключити головний каталог, потрібно правильно відформатувати URL-адресу. Нижче наведено приклади правильно відформатованих URL-адрес, у яких використовуються різні способи визначення домену (указувати номер порту необов’язково).
- Включити головний каталог:
sftp://example.com//home/jon/upload.csv
(за допомогою доменного імені)sftp://142.250.189.4:1234//home/jon/upload.csv
(за допомогою адреси IPv4 з указаним номером порту)
- Виключити головний каталог:
sftp://example.com/upload.csv
(за допомогою доменного імені)sftp://[2607:f8b0:4007:817::2004]:1234/upload.csv
(за допомогою адреси IPv6 з указаним номером порту)
Якщо файл для завантаження розміщується в підкаталозі головного каталогу, URL-адреса матиме такий вигляд:
sftp://example.com//home/jon/data/upload.csv
У такому випадку можна застосувати наведені нижче типи форматів.
- Включити головний каталог:
sftp://example.com//home/jon/data/upload.csv
sftp://142.250.189.4:1234//home/jon/data/upload.csv
(за допомогою адреси IPv4 з указаним номером порту)
- Виключити головний каталог:
sftp://example.com/data/upload.csv
sftp://[2607:f8b0:4007:817::2004]:1234/data/upload.csv
(за допомогою адреси IPv6 з указаним номером порту)
Якщо файл для завантаження не зберігається в головному каталозі (//home/jon
) або його підкаталозі (//home/jon/data
), а натомість розміщується в каталозі /foo/bar, то правильно відформатована URL-адреса файлу для завантаження матиме такий вигляд:
sftp://example.com//foo/bar/upload.csv
(каталог //foo/bar
замінює головний каталог)
Як переглянути відомості про джерело даних, видалити його, отримати відкритий ключ SFTP й імпортувати нові дані
- На сторінці адміністратора у розділі Збирання й змінення даних натисніть Імпортування даних.
За попереднім посиланням відкриється останній ресурс Analytics, у який ви входили. Щоб змінити ресурс, скористайтеся засобом вибору ресурсу.
Ви повинні мати принаймні права перегляду на рівні ресурсу, щоб переглянути інформацію про джерело даних.
- У рядку джерела даних натисніть значок .
Ви можете переглянути назву, тип даних, відкритий ключ і історію кожного завантаження.
- Відкритий ключ. Ключ сервера SFTP, який відповідає секретному ключу, що зберігається в Analytics (до нього нікому не надається доступ), і який використовується для безпечного й конфіденційного з’єднання між вашим сервером і серверами Analytics під час імпортування даних. Для цього такий відкритий ключ слід спершу авторизувати на своєму сервері.
- Імпортовано (%). Відношення кількості успішно імпортованих рядків до кількості рядків у файлі імпорту. 100% означає, що всі рядки успішно імпортовано.
- Коефіцієнт збігу. Частка ключів у файлі імпорту, які можна знайти у вашому ресурсі протягом останніх 90 днів. 100% означає, що всі дані корисні й актуальні для ваших даних протягом останніх 90 днів.
Примітка. % імпорту й коефіцієнт збігу стосуються імпорту даних про вартість, товари й спеціальні події, але не застосовуються до імпорту даних про користувачів або офлайн-подій.
Щоб імпортувати нові дані, виконайте наведені нижче вказівки.
Натисніть Імпортувати й виберіть файл CSV на комп’ютері.
Щоб видалити джерело даних:
- Натисніть значок > Видалити джерело даних.
- Прочитайте примітку про видалення й натисніть Видалити джерело даних.
Ви можете видалити дані, імпортовані під час збирання чи обробки, однак якщо ви захочете вилучити дані, завантажені з усіх оброблених Analytics подій, вам, імовірно, потрібно буде видалити користувача або його властивість. Якщо видалити імпортований файл, це не призведе до вилучення оброблених даних, пов’язаних із подіями, зареєстрованими після імпорту. Докладніше про запити на видалення даних.
Зарезервовані назви й префікси
Указані нижче префікси й назви подій і їх параметрів та властивостей користувача зарезервовано для використання в Analytics. Дані, які містять зарезервовані назви чи параметри, не завантажуватимуться.
Приклади
- Якщо спробувати імпортувати подію із зарезервованою назвою, цю подію і її параметри не буде імпортовано.
- Якщо спробувати імпортувати подію з дійсною назвою, коли один із її параметрів має зарезервовану назву, цю подію буде імпортовано, а її параметр – ні.
Зарезервовані назви подій
- ad_activeview
- ad_activeview
- ad_exposure
- ad_impression
- ad_query
- adunit_exposure
- app_clear_data
- app_install
- app_remove
- app_update
- error
- first_open
- first_visit
- in_app_purchase
- notification_dismiss
- notification_foreground
- notification_open
- notification_receive
- os_update
- screen_view
- session_start
- user_engagement
Зарезервовані назви параметрів події
- firebase_conversion
Зарезервовані назви властивостей користувача
- first_open_after_install
- first_open_time
- first_visit_time
- last_deep_link_referrer
- user_id
Зарезервовані префікси (для параметрів подій і властивостей користувача)
- ga_
- google_
- firebase_